“Gaining unlimited weight” isn’t the alternative to restricting and engaging in disordered eating thought processes. Intuitive eating is. And yes, some people who begin to practice intuitive eating will gain weight if they’ve been keeping themselves artificially below their set points, but you are tipping your hand here with the idea that you’ll just get fatter and fatter until you’re some unimaginable whale if you stop restricting. If you actually want to reject diet culture, just, like, do it. I promise it’s not that scary.

Also, I’d love less focus (in the comments, not so much in your post) on how larger bodies could be considered beautiful. Because it isn’t about that. We don’t need to replace one externally imposed beauty standard with a different one. “Baby Got Back” isn’t body liberation, it just expands access to privilege to a few additional bodies. I frankly do not care if people find me beautiful, I want to stop experiencing material discrimination from everyone from doctors to retailers to designers of public seating *regardless* of whether they personally want to have sex with me.

Yes, thank you for the inspired conversation! Being "priced out of paradise" is an injustice for any people! I am part of that problem since I bought land here coming from California. I want to make a difference in that department in two ways:

(1). I want transplants to consider creating a large trust that they contribute their land back into when they die, so the Hawaiian people CAN afford to live here. The Bishop Estate Trust, which was created for this purpose long ago, has a tarnished reputation and many no longer trust it. Having been a trust attorney for decades, I think we can learn from that old trust, write a new one, and begin to return the land back to the Hawaiians.

(2). I'd like to create sovereign sustainable communities here so living in off-the grid luxury is affordable for everyone! We now have the technologies to make this possible. We can create our own clean drinking water with atomospheric water generators, and most of the Island has enough rainwater to do the rest. We can create our own off the grid energy with plenty of sunshine. We can now have internet available to anyone who can be seen from satellite. I'm in the process of developing a flushable toilet that processes the sewage using electricity before it passes to the earth in cesspool (90% of housing is cesspool on this island). We have this toilet on sailboats already (Lectrasan), but no one has brought it to the land yet. These technologies make it possible to be "sovereign" from the centralized government systems that keep us dependent on their pipes, sewers, electric grids, etc. These services are out of date and cost us billions! The land that has always been too remote for central govt. utilities is still inexpensive, and there is lots of it here. If we can get zoning that allows for condos on agricultural land, then several families could grow their own food and form communities that are self-sufficient. That's my dream for all of us!
